Body:Section 8-1-60

Thing let for particular purpose to be so used.

When a thing is let for a particular purpose, the lessee must not use it for any other purpose; and if he does, he is liable to the lessor for all damages resulting from such use, or the lessor may treat the contract as thereby rescinded.

(Code 1923, §6273; Code 1940, T. 9, §7.)
